10 Things You Must Know About Heavy Duty Horizontal Slurry Pump

19 Jul.,2024

 

When it comes to the mining or industrial process, the crucial task is the transportation of slurry from one point to another. Heavy Duty Horizontal Slurry pumps are designed to handle the toughest abrasive and corrosive slurry environments. These pumps are also used in different industrial applications, including transportation of heavy slurries, mineral processing, and chemical plants.

Here are the top 10 things that you should know about heavy-duty horizontal slurry pumps:

1. Robust construction: The slurry pumps are constructed with high-quality materials like iron, steel, and rubber, ensuring durability and reliability.

2. Design and operation: The pumps are designed for continuous operation, and their basic operation is relatively simple. Once the slurry enters the pump, the liquid and solids are separated by the impeller, which forces the solid particles to move to the discharge port.

3. Efficiency: Heavy Duty Horizontal Slurry pumps are highly efficient and can deliver high-performance results, even under severe operating conditions.

4. Speed: These pumps can be customized to handle different speeds, depending on the viscosity of the slurry to be pumped.

5. Pressure: Heavy Duty Horizontal Slurry pumps can deliver high pressures, making them ideal for transporting slurry over long distances.

6. Maintenance: Proper maintenance is essential for the longevity and optimal performance of the slurry pumps. Regular inspections and replacement of parts like impellers and liners can help to prevent downtime and extend the life of the pump.

7. Technology: Advanced technology has been incorporated into the design and operation of Heavy Duty Horizontal Slurry pumps, making them capable of handling harsh conditions and corrosive environments.

8. Customization: The pumps can be customized to meet specific requirements and applications, ensuring that they are fully optimized for the intended use.

9. Versatile: Heavy Duty Horizontal Slurry pumps can work in different environments, including processes like mineral processing, chemical plants, and coal mining, amongst others.

10. Cost-effective: Investing in heavy-duty horizontal slurry pumps can be cost-effective, as they have a long lifespan, reducing the need for frequent replacement and minimizing downtime.
